Business Innovation Support Network for the Czech Republic – Enhancing the innovation management capacities of SMEs by EEN in 2014

Objective

The overall aim of the project is to introduce services “Enhancing the innovation management capacity of SME's” by the Enterprise Europe Network in the Czech Republic to SMEs with significant innovation activities and in particular to the beneficiaries of the SME Instrument. The activities of the project are directed to deal with the lack of quality and affordable services for SMEs in the area of innovation management in the Czech Republic and the lack of innovation management capacity in Czech SMEs.
In general, the project aims to achieve to set up and run the standardised system for enhancing the innovation management capacity of beneficiaries of the SME Instrument under Horizon 2020, and of SMEs with significant innovation activities and a high potential for internationalisation. There are two parallel processes in place to fulfil the objectives:
1. All the beneficiaries of the SME Instrument under Horizon 2020 will be contacted by experienced Key Account Managers upon notification from EASME. Key Account Managers will meet in person with relevant representatives of the beneficiaries in order to describe the full scope of the support offered, and ask for confirmation to proceed with the identification of growth opportunities and setting up the coaching service process, which they will mediate.
2. Small and medium sized enterprises with significant innovation activities and a high potential for internationalisation will be identified by a well-defined selection process based on experiences of the staff involved in the project. Selected SMEs will be offered with comprehensive seven-day service packages enhancing their innovation management capacities as described in detailed in the project proposal. It is critically important to identify the right SMEs, which have the potential to benefit the most from the service to maximize the impact of the intervention on the company’s future growth.
